Train collides with school van in West Bengal’s Murshidabad, at least three dead

It was stated that the accident occurred around 07:00 in the morning. (Screenshot/x@PTI_News)

At least three people, including children, died when a train collided with a school minibus in West Bengal’s Murshidabad district on Friday, July 17. Hundreds of people gathered at the railway crossing where the accident occurred to save those who lost their lives in the accident and those who survived.

According to preliminary information, it was stated that two of the three people killed were minors. It was stated that the accident occurred around 07:00 in the morning.

The surviving injured were taken to Murshidabad Medical College and Hospital. It was learned that some of the injured were in critical condition and their treatment was ongoing.

Authorities have not yet made an official statement. A team of 10 people from the railways reached the scene.

The accident took place at the railway level crossing near Karna Subarna Railway Station in Murshidabad. It was reported that the minibus was hit by a train while trying to pass through the level crossing.

However, so far there has been no official statement from the railway or the administration.
